Resources can be optimized through this type of sharing by allowing users to access reports, dashboards, and data that can possibly be just what they require to complete a task or analysis. Let’s picture an ambiance where business users can make use of a business intelligence and analysis portal and view the popular data that can be rated, shared, and commented on. How Social BI Helps Businesses Attain Success Improved results in product development, projects, business processes, and quality control can be seen through social BI’s data sharing and analysis across teams, divisions, and business units. It also includes the skill to generate and share reports and data without the help of data scientists or any staff from the IT department. One of the most imperative features of social BI is its ability to create self-served and user-generated analysis, coupled with the application of business user knowledge. Confident decisions can be taken by employing social BI, as it puts all the users on the same page with regards to activities, tasks, and goals being driven by a shared understanding and use of analytical tools and results. Analytical tools are used to achieve user understanding and comfort. This is done using interactive Business Intelligence and Analytics dashboards along with intuitive tools to improve data clarity. Social BI indicates the process of gathering, analyzing, publishing, and sharing data, reports, and information. Let us take a look into the individual concepts of social and collaborative business intelligence to learn more about how they help companies. This can be done with the help of socializing ideas within an Enterprise Business Intelligence tool, be it with or without an Enterprise Social Network (ESN).
